background  

FtsH protease is important in chloroplast biogenesis and thylakoid maintenance. Nuclear genome of Arabidopsis thaliana contains 12 genes encoding FtsH proteins. Three of those gene products  in Arabidopsis , can be targeted to mitochondria  (FTSH3, FTSH4, and FTSH10), while  the other nine (FTSH1, FTSH2, FTSH5 to FTSH9, FTSH11, and FTSH12) can enter the chloroplast. Synonyme: cell division protease FtsH homolog 9, chloroplastic.
